网站首页
编程语言
数据库
系统相关
其他分享
编程问答
getReader
2024-08-07
SpringBoot项目中HTTP请求体只能读一次?试试这方案
问题描述在基于Spring开发Java项目时,可能需要重复读取HTTP请求体中的数据,例如使用拦截器打印入参信息等,但当我们重复调用getInputStream()或者getReader()时,通常会遇到类似以下的错误信息:大体的意思是当前request的getInputStream()已经被调用过了。那为什么会出现这个问题呢?
2023-02-24
遭遇getReader() has already been called for this request错误
该错误的原因是HttpServletRequest的getInputStream()和getReader()只能调用一次,【getReader()底层调用了getInputStream()】。@RequestBody也是流的形式读取,流读取一次就
2023-02-10
持续读取响应内容
请求响应已开始但未结束前持续获取响应的内容constgetContent=async(e:any)=>{e.preventDefault();setLoading(true);awaitfetch("/api/content"
2022-11-24
js 为Array实现一个Reader,通过接口getReader获取,Reader 有一个接口 read(n)
为Array实现一个Reader,通过接口getReader获取,Reader有一个接口read(n)每次调用会按顺序读区数组的n(默认为1)个元素,调用不会改变数组本身的值,若数组已全部读取完则返回空